Nov 7, 2020 · Financial Analyst. Median Salary: $61,224. Projected Growth: 5% from 2019 to 2029. Many finance majors find careers as financial analysts. Financial analysts use a collection of information—like economic trends, business news, and corporate strategies—to assess the performance of stocks, bonds, and other investments. Financial managers monitor a company's financial health and activity in order to minimize risk and maximize profit. They are responsible for generating financial statements and providing advice to upper management on how to direct the company's wealth and financial planning. The main difference between a finance degree and an economics degree is the focus and scope of the study. A finance degree focuses on the practical aspects of managing money and financial assets. On the other hand, an economics degree is more theoretical and broad-based, covering a wide range of economic concepts and principles.Finance majors are students who learn how to optimize business operations with financial planning, forecasting and investment opportunities. Financial advisors can be generalists, or they may specialize in one of several areas, including retirement, taxes, estate planning, or insurance and risk management.Job Outlook. Overall employment of financial analysts is projected to grow 8 percent from 2022 to 2032, faster than the average for all occupations. About 27,400 openings for financial analysts are projected each year, on average, over the decade.
